WCF-NetMsmq 傳輸屬性對話方塊,接收,繫結索引標籤

 

使用 [ 結] 索引標籤來定義WCF-NetMsmq接收配接器專屬的系結屬性。 WCF-NetMsmq 接收配接器可以透過 MSMQ 傳輸上的二進位編碼訊息,與服務進行通訊。 WCF-NetMsmq 配接器會在 .NET 對 .NET 的環境中,提供佇列的通訊。

使用 作法
啟用等候逾時 (hh:mmss) 指定時間值,表示可供完成通道開啟作業的時間間隔。 這個值應大於或等於 System.TimeSpan.Zero

預設值:00:01:00

最大值:23:59:59
傳送逾時 (hh:mmss) 指定時間值,表示可供完成傳送作業的時間間隔。 這個值應大於或等於 System.TimeSpan.Zero

預設值:00:01:00

最大值:23:59:59
關閉逾時 (hh:mmss) 指定時間值,表示可供完成通道關閉作業的時間間隔。 這個值應大於或等於 System.TimeSpan.Zero

預設值:00:01:00

最大值:23:59:59
接收訊息大小上限 (以位元組為單位) 以位元組為單位,指定可在網路上接收的訊息大小上限 (含標頭)。 訊息的大小受限於配置給每個訊息的記憶體數量。 您可以使用這個屬性來限制遭受拒絕服務 (DoS) 攻擊的風險程度。

預設值:65536

最大值:2147483647
異動 指定訊息佇列的類型:交易式或非交易式。 如果選取這個屬性,則每個訊息只會傳遞一次,而且會通知傳送者傳遞失敗。 若要透過交易式傳送埠傳送訊息,用戶端的 持久性確切的Once 繫結項目都必須設定為 true。 如果清除這個屬性,便會傳輸訊息而不提供傳遞保證。 注意: 如果您在這個接收位置下使用交易式佇列,則必須選取這個屬性。 注意: ReplaceThisText

預設值為選取核取方塊。
已排序的處理 指定是否連續處理訊息。 選取這個屬性時,這個接收位置會配合 BizTalk 傳訊或協調流程傳送埠搭配使用的已排序訊息傳遞,且已 排序的傳遞 選項設定為 True。 只有在選取 [交易 ] 屬性時,才能選取此選項。

如需 Ordered Delivery 選項的詳細資訊,請參閱「請參閱」中的適當主題。

選取此屬性,也可以將配接器以單一執行緒方式,在處理大型訊息時將資源使用最佳化。 如需有關傳送和接收大型訊息的詳細資訊,請參閱<另請參閱>中的適當主題。

預設值為清除核取方塊。
同時呼叫數目上限 指定對單一服務執行個體的並行呼叫數目。 超出上限的呼叫將排入佇列。 將此值設定為 0 相當於將它設定為 Int32.MaxValue

預設值:200

另請參閱

如何設定WCF-NetMsmq在交易內傳送和擷取訊息的接收位置排序傳遞